Role overview

Agrosilos União is hiring for a part-time Data Analyst at an entry or junior level in Sydney, New South Wales. The position combines on-site work with work-from-home flexibility. It is aimed at people who are beginning their analytics career and want to build experience while being supported by more experienced colleagues.

What you will do

  • Gather data from internal systems, spreadsheets, and reporting sources.
  • Clean, structure, and organise datasets so they are ready for analysis and reporting.
  • Carry out basic analysis to identify patterns, trends, and useful business takeaways.
  • Build simple dashboards and visual reports to support operational and strategic decisions.
  • Help the team turn data into practical insights for day-to-day and longer-term planning.
  • Document analytical steps and workflows so processes are easy to follow and repeat.
  • Maintain strong data quality standards while checking for accuracy and consistency.
  • Work with colleagues across functions to understand data needs and explain findings clearly.

What the role calls for

The ideal candidate will have a solid grounding in analytics and a willingness to learn on the job. The role suits someone who can interpret data at a basic level, communicate findings in a simple and clear way, and handle spreadsheet-based work with confidence. Exposure to reporting tools, databases, or SQL will be an advantage.

Qualifications and skills

  • Strong analytical ability and an introductory understanding of data analysis concepts.
  • Basic statistics knowledge for descriptive analysis and decision support.
  • Ability to model data in a simple way for reporting, dashboards, and light forecasting.
  • Good written and verbal communication skills for reports and stakeholder interaction.
  • Comfort using Excel, Google Sheets, or similar spreadsheet tools.
  • Some familiarity with Power BI, Tableau, or other data visualisation tools is helpful.
  • Awareness of databases or SQL is beneficial.
  • Attention to detail and a proactive attitude toward learning new tools and methods.
  • Relevant study or practical background in Data Science, Statistics, Mathematics, Computer Science, Business, or a related area is preferred, though equivalent experience may also work.
